DEFS = -D__WINE__ TOPSRCDIR = @top_srcdir@ TOPOBJDIR = ../.. SRCDIR = @srcdir@ VPATH = @srcdir@ YACCOPT = #-v PROGRAMS = wmc MODULE = none C_SRCS = \ lang.c \ mcl.c \ utils.c \ wmc.c \ write.c EXTRA_SRCS = mcy.y EXTRA_OBJS = y.tab.o all: $(PROGRAMS) mcl.o: y.tab.h @MAKE_RULES@ wmc: $(OBJS) $(TOPOBJDIR)/unicode/libwine_unicode.$(LIBEXT) $(CC) $(CFLAGS) -o wmc $(OBJS) $(LIBUNICODE) $(LEXLIB) $(LDFLAGS) $(TOPOBJDIR)/unicode/libwine_unicode.$(LIBEXT): cd `dirname $@` && $(MAKE) `basename $@` y.tab.c y.tab.h: mcy.y $(YACC) $(YACCOPT) -d -t $(SRCDIR)/mcy.y clean:: $(RM) y.tab.c y.tab.h y.output install:: $(PROGRAMS) [ -d $(bindir) ] || $(MKDIR) $(bindir) [ -d $(mandir)/man$(prog_manext) ] || $(MKDIR) $(mandir)/man$(prog_manext) $(INSTALL_DATA) $(SRCDIR)/wmc.man $(mandir)/man$(prog_manext)/wmc.$(prog_manext) $(INSTALL_PROGRAM) wmc $(bindir)/wmc uninstall:: $(RM) $(bindir)/wmc $(mandir)/man$(prog_manext)/wmc.$(prog_manext) ### Dependencies: